I was looking at Madisound's Recession Buster kit and wondered if it would work in a BIB?
http://www.madisound.com/catalog/pr...com/catalog/product_info.php?products_id=8525
It looks to me like a box that is 8.5X11.5X64.1 (inches) and a 26.5 inch z would work. I got these numbers using Zilla's calculator.
I'm not sure where the tweeter would mount, but it could be moved around for optimum positioning based on the listener's on axis position. I have no idea how to go about figuring BSC on this one, though.
Any ideas, good, bad, or indifferent???

That sure looks like a deal! WRT the BIB, I recommend going ahead and using T.C.'s original design height which changes the dims to:
height (in) 69.006
depth (in) 9.838
width (in) 6.957
A-B-C (in) 4.919
driver offset (in) 29.949
driver offset - sub (in) 59.898
driver height (in) 39.808
driver height - sub (in) 9.859
L (in) 138.013
Sm (in^2) 68.445
net Vb (ft^3) 2.73329
baffle thickness (in) 0.750
zdriver 0.217
zdriver - sub 0.434
Fs 48.78
Vas (ft^3) 0.3708
Qts 0.45
SoS (in/sec) 13464.54
All dims approximate and damp to suit. If you back it up against a wall it probably won't need any BSC.
Anyway, if you build BIBs, please post the actual size chosen, your thoughts on its performance, etc. and link to it on the huge BIB thread.
Assuming no test gear, hook up the tweeter and move it around the perimeter of the woofer's circumference till it's loudest on average at the highest frequencies across the 'sweet spot'.
